      Sec. 36a-498b. Release of secondary mortgage. Notice of outstanding balance 
of obligation secured by secondary mortgage. (a) Each mortgage lender, mortgage 
correspondent lender and mortgage broker, all as defined in section 36a-485 and licensed 
under section 36a-489, shall deliver to the mortgagor a release of a secondary mortgage: 
(1) Upon receipt by such licensee of cash or a certified check in the amount of the 
outstanding balance of the obligation secured by such mortgage; or (2) upon payment 
by the payor bank, as defined in section 42a-4-105, of any check that is payable to such 
licensee or its assignee in the amount of the outstanding balance of the obligation secured 
by such mortgage.
      (b) Each such licensee shall advise any person designated by the mortgagor of the 
amount of the outstanding balance of the obligation secured by the secondary mortgage 
granted to such licensee no later than the second business day after the licensee receives 
a request for such information.
      (P.A. 08-176, S. 55.)
      History: P.A. 08-176 effective July 1, 2008.
